		<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>as Doug Mccauley pointed out, Duracell Instant is 1150 mAh, not 2000. Looks like they advertised it wrong on their page and Kevin probably got the specs from there(<a href="http://www.duracell.com/us/smartpower/products_PowerReserve.asp" rel="nofollow">http://www.duracell.com/us/smartpower/products_PowerReserve.asp</a>).</p>
<p>For anyone interested, it&#8217;s output power is 0.6A at 5V, so it might NOT chager some of the smartphones that needs 1A at 5V.</p>
